Virtual media repository
The virtual media repository provides a single container to store and manage file-backed virtual optical media files. Media stored in the repository can be loaded into file-backed virtual optical devices for exporting to client partitions.
Only one repository can be created within a Virtual I/O Server.
The virtual media repository is available with Virtual I/O Server Version 1.5 or later.
The virtual media repository is created and managed using the following commands.
Command | Description |
---|---|
chrep | Changes the characteristics of the virtual media repository |
chvopt | Changes the characteristics of a virtual optical media |
loadopt | Loads file-backed virtual optical media into a file-backed virtual optical device |
lsrep | Displays information about the virtual media repository |
lsvopt | Displays information about file-backed virtual optical devices |
mkrep | Creates the virtual media repository |
mkvdev | Creates file-backed virtual optical devices |
mkvopt | Creates file-backed virtual optical media |
rmrep | Removes the virtual media repository |
rmvopt | Removes file-backed virtual optical media |
unloadopt | Unloads file-backed virtual optical media from a file-backed virtual optical device |
